Kubernetes集群管理

2023-12-09 09:19   SPDC科技洞察   

Kuberees集群管理:自动化、可扩展和高效的新标准

随着云计算和容器技术的快速发展,Kuberees已经成为了容器编排和集群管理的事实标准。Kuberees提供了强大的集群管理能力,包括自动化部署、弹性扩展、资源管理和安全控制等,帮助开发者更高效地构建和运行应用程序。

一、Kuberees集群管理的基本概念

Kuberees(也称为K8s)是一个开源的容器编排系统,它可以让开发者轻松地部署、扩展和管理容器化的应用程序。Kuberees集群是由一组节点组成的分布式系统,这些节点可以运行在同一个云平台或不同的云平台,形成一个松耦合、高可用的系统。

二、Kuberees集群管理的优势

1. 自动化部署:Kuberees提供了自动化部署的工具,可以通过定义好的Deployme对象,实现应用的自动化部署和升级。

2. 弹性扩展:Kuberees集群可以根据应用负载的情况自动扩展或缩减节点数量,保持系统的可用性和性能。

3. 资源管理:Kuberees可以合理地分配和调度集群中的资源,保证各种应用能够公平地使用资源,提高整体的系统性能。

4. 安全控制:Kuberees提供了强大的安全控制功能,包括身份认证、访问控制和加密通信等,保证集群的安全性和稳定性。

三、如何进行Kuberees集群管理

1. 配置和管理集群:使用kubecl命令行工具来配置和管理Kuberees集群。通过这个工具,可以创建、查询和修改各种资源对象,包括Pods、Services、Deploymes等。

2. 监控集群状态:使用Kuberees的监控工具(如Heapser、Promeheus等)来收集和分析集群的性能数据,帮助及时发现和解决潜在问题。

3. 维护集群健康:定期检查集群的健康状况,包括检查节点状态、资源使用情况等,及时发现并解决潜在的问题。

4. 优化集群性能:根据监控数据和实际需求,不断优化集群的性能和资源利用率,提高系统的整体性能。

四、总结

Kuberees集群管理为开发者提供了一种高效、可扩展和自动化的解决方案,可以帮助他们更好地构建和运行应用程序。通过使用Kuberees,开发者可以更专注于应用的开发和优化,而不用担心后端的运维问题。因此,学习和掌握Kuberees集群管理对于现代开发者来说是至关重要的。

相关阅读

  • Docker容器应用实践

    Docker容器应用实践

    Docker容器应用实践:从入门到精通 1. 引言随着云计算的快速发展,Docker容器技术逐

  • 云原生架构模式

    云原生架构模式

    云原生架构模式:构建高效、可扩展的现代应用 随着云计算技术的不断发展,云原生架构模式正在改变企

  • Kubernetes集群管理

    Kubernetes集群管理

    Kuberees集群管理:自动化、可扩展和高效的新标准 随着云计算和容器技术的快速发展,Kub

  • 容器镜像构建与管理

    容器镜像构建与管理

    容器镜像构建与管理一、容器镜像概念 容器镜像(Coaier Image)是Docker容器的静

  • 容器网络与存储解决方案

    容器网络与存储解决方案

    容器网络与存储解决方案一、容器网络解决方案 随着容器技术的普及,容器网络解决方案也变得越来越重

  • 容器化与虚拟化对比

    容器化与虚拟化对比

    容器化与虚拟化:定义、技术原理及优劣分析 ===================引言--在当今

  • 容器化部署实战案例

    容器化部署实战案例

    容器化部署实战案例 1. 引言随着云计算的快速发展,容器化技术逐渐成为了一种主流的部署方式。容

  • Kubernetes集群管理

    Kubernetes集群管理

    Kuberees集群管理:自动化、可扩展和高效的新标准 随着云计算和容器技术的快速发展,Kub

  • 云原生架构模式

    云原生架构模式

    云原生架构模式:构建高效、可扩展的现代应用 随着云计算技术的不断发展,云原生架构模式正在改变软

  • Docker容器应用实践

    Docker容器应用实践

    1. 引言 Docker是一种开源平台,用于构建、打包和运行应用程序。它使用容器化技术,使应用